Hydrodynamic event-plane correlations in Pb+Pb collisions at sqrt(s)=2.76ATeV

The recently measured correlations between the flow angles associated with higher harmonics in the anisotropic flow generated in relativistic heavy-ion collisions are shown to be of hydrodynamic origin. The correlation strength is found to be sensitive to both the initial conditions and the shear viscosity of the expanding fireball medium.
